Understanding the Different Types of Headsets

Headsets come in a variety of types and styles, including:

1. Over-ear Headsets

Over-ear headsets fully enclose your ears, providing excellent sound quality and noise cancellation. They're great for gaming, music, and making phone calls.

2. On-ear Headsets

On-ear headsets sit on top of your ears, rather than fully enclosing them. They're generally more compact than over-ear headsets, making them ideal for travel and on-the-go use.

3. In-ear Headsets

In-ear headsets are small and lightweight, making them perfect for exercising and other physical activities. They're also great for taking phone calls on the go.

4. Bluetooth Headsets

Bluetooth headsets use wireless technology to connect to your device, giving you more freedom of movement. They're great for use with smartphones and other mobile devices, and many models offer excellent battery life.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Headset

When choosing a headset, there are several factors to consider:

1. Comfort

If you plan on wearing your headset for extended periods, comfort is essential. Look for models with padded ear cups and adjustable headbands.

2. Sound Quality

Whether you're listening to music or taking phone calls, you want your headset to deliver clear, high-quality sound. Look for models with noise-cancelling technology and good microphone quality.

3. Compatibility

Make sure your headset is compatible with your device of choice. Many headsets are compatible with a wide range of devices, but it's always worth double-checking before you make a purchase.

4. Price

Headsets are available at a range of price points, so consider your budget when making your choice. While more expensive models may offer additional features, there are plenty of affordable options that still deliver great performance.

5. Purpose

Consider the purpose of your headset. Will you be using it for work, gaming, or personal use? Different types of headsets may be better suited for different purposes.

6. Wired vs. Wireless

Consider whether you prefer the reliability of a wired connection or the freedom of wireless connectivity.

7. Brand Reputation

Consider the reputation of the brand when choosing a headset. Look for brands with a history of producing high-quality headsets and providing good customer support.
